Green Presenter - Home Star Legislation

The Home Star  program would create the first ever nationwide rebate program for energy efficiency work and is included as a proposal in the larger jobs bill currently under development in the Senate. Home Star will direct $9.6 billion to be spent in the first year alone on efficiency work.  Home Star is not yet law, but with the help of energy efficiency business like yours, we can ensure that this game-changing legislation becomes reality.

Stephen Michael Self is president of Able Ideas Consulting, owner of Sustainable Interiors and co-founder of Kansas Institute.  Stephen has presented nationally on topics ranging from energy efficiency, green building, sustainable business practices and comprehensive energy legislation. Stephen’s qualifications include AIA CES Registered Provider, RESNET Certified HERS Rater, RESNET Green Rater, Efficiency First State Chair and licensed General Contractor.
